Transaction 21fdf80f3a2a95399114ea784a715f74c95e3749e1831938b84d59803f120804
2 Input
2 Outputs
- 21fdf80f3a2a95399114ea784a715f74c95e3749e1831938b84d59803f120804:0
- 21fdf80f3a2a95399114ea784a715f74c95e3749e1831938b84d59803f120804:1
value 8520
address 1Gqey2sp67PQNeXgYRztRECawiBYtzfVcg
value 33890000
address 32BLBzJinnuDEpyN2inzcZZNMhQ2zZGRwr